    Abstract: A bath container for cooling a liquid contained therein for use in refrigeration equipment includes a jacket bounding a space for the liquid which comprises a side wall and a bottom wall. The side wall of the jacket is formed of two individual walls spaced from one another to form a hollow chamber therebetween which chamber is connected to a refrigerant feeding member and to a refrigerant discharging member whereby the jacket forming the hollow chamber and adapted to pass the refrigerant therethrough functions as an evaporator. A surface heating element including a heating wire inserted into a relatively thick insulating packing is mounted on the surface of the bottom side to supply heat to the working liquid contained in the bath container.

    Abstract: In the oxidation of propylene and/or acrolein, high-boiling or non-volatile byproducts are separated from the solvents used for absorbing the acrylic acid by treating the said solvents laden with byproducts with the hot reaction gases in such amounts that the major portion of the solvents evaporates, the residual solvent containing a high percentage of said byproducts then being discarded or worked up.

    Abstract: In the oxidation of .alpha.-olefins in the gas phase to .alpha.,.beta.-olefinically unsaturated aldehydes and carboxylic acids with molecular oxygen in the presence of an inert gas using a catalyst containing molybdenum and bismuth with elements as oxides or mixed oxides at from 280.degree. to 450.degree. C a content of indium and/or aluminum and/or lanthanum and/or gallium as oxide or mixed oxide results in an improvement in the conversion and/or activity and/or life of the catalyst.

    Abstract: Acrylic acid practically devoid of water, acrolein, formaldehyde and acetic acid is obtained at particularly low cost by countercurrent scrubbing and quenching of the reaction gas formed in the catalytic oxidation of propylene and/or acrolein with a high-boiling, extremely hydrophobic solvent followed by processing of the extract.
